> In 'Data Sharing' what access are provided for 'read' access and 'write'
> access?
> IMO
> Read Access
> 1. Should be able to view the experiment or the project.
> 2. If its an experiment should be able to download inputs and outputs.
> 3. Should be able to launch, clone the experiment.
> 4. Should not be able to Cancel an ongoing experiment.
> 5. Should not be able to share or un-share the shared experiment or project
> with others.
> Write Access
> 1. All above privileges 1, 2, 3 of 'Read' access should be available.
> 2. Should be able to cancel an ongoing shared experiment.
> 3, Should be able to share the experiment and projects with others.
> 4. Should not be able to remove the owner of the project or experiment.
